What Is Heat Resistant RTV?

Heat Resistant RTV (Room Temperature Vulcanizing) silicone is like the superhero of sealants. It’s a flexible sealant that can withstand elevated temperatures without losing its grip. If you’ve ever felt the frustration of a sealant failing in the heat, you know just how important this feature is.

RTV silicone typically starts as a sticky paste that cures at room temperature, transforming into a durable elastomer. So, whether you’re sealing gaps in your furnace or just lining your oven, this material has superhuman heat resistance, often surviving temperatures up to 500°F (260°C) or beyond. Plus, it’s perfect for applications involving metals, plastics, and even glass.

Key Properties and Benefits

The benefits of Heat Resistant RTV go beyond just heat tolerance – it’s like the Swiss Army knife of sealants:

  • High Temperature Resistance: As mentioned, it can handle fiery heat without losing its efficacy.
  • Flexibility: This sealant can stretch and compress, making it applicable in various scenarios where movement is likely.
  • Longevity: Once cured, it’s durable and can last for years, even under harsh conditions.
  • Waterproof: Worried about moisture? This silicone is water-resistant, keeping your surfaces safe from unwanted leaks.
  • Chemical Resistance: If you’re working in an environment with oils or solvents, you’re in luck. RTV can tolerate a good amount of chemical exposure without getting all flaky.

Applications of Heat Resistant RTV

You might be surprised at just how versatile Heat Resistant RTV can be:

  • Automotive Uses: It’s popular in the auto industry for sealing gaskets and oil pans. Who knew your car needed a spa day?
  • HVAC Systems: Keep those heating and cooling units working smoothly with a good dose of RTV.
  • Household Repair: From fixing small appliances to patching up worn-out oven seals, this sealant has got you covered.
  • Marine Applications: Whether it’s a boat engine or the hull, heat resistant RTV is ideal for withstanding tough marine conditions.

Choosing the Right Heat Resistant RTV

With various types available, how do you pick the right one? Here’s a quick cheat sheet:

  • Temperature Rating: Always check the maximum temperature rating: you don’t want to bake your sealant.
  • Cure Time: Some products cure faster than others, so consider your project’s timeline.
  • Color: Whether you want a clear seal or a specific color to match your materials, options abound.
  • Application Method: Some come in handy caulk tubes, while others require a caulking gun. Choose based on your comfort level.

Pro tip: Always check the manufacturer’s recommendations to make sure you’re using the right product for your specific needs.

Application Techniques

Now that you’ve picked your Heat Resistant RTV, let’s talk about how to apply it like a pro:

  1. Surface Preparation: Make sure the surfaces are clean and dry. Remove any old sealant, dirt, or grease.
  2. Cut the Nozzle: Trim the nozzle to the desired bead size. Remember, cutting smaller is better: you can always squeeze more in.
  3. Apply Evenly: Squeeze a steady stream of sealant into the gap, keeping it consistent. Don’t rush: good things take time.
  4. Smooth it Out: Use a caulk finishing tool or your finger (after wetting it.) to smooth out the bead. It’s like giving your project a nice little spa treatment.
  5. Curing Time: Allow the sealant to cure as per the package instructions, patience is key.

Safety Considerations and Best Practices

Safety always comes first, so keep these best practices in mind:

  • Ventilation: Ensure your workspace is ventilated. Those fumes can make you feel a bit wobbly, and not the good kind.
  • Use Protective Gear: Gloves, goggles, and a mask can be your best friends in ensuring safety while using silicones.
  • Follow Directions: Always read the label. Each product has specific instructions for optimal safety and use.
  • Storage: Store your RTV in a cool, dry place. Nobody wants an expired sealant getting all funky.
